On 24/8/26 14:29, Daniel P. Berrangé wrote:
Expand the text a bit to make the new syntax more explicit and point
users to the man page for further info.

Reported-by: Peter Maydell <[email protected]>
Signed-off-by: Daniel P. Berrangé <[email protected]>
---
  system/vl.c | 7 +++++--
  1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/system/vl.c b/system/vl.c
index 061cbdf860..d5b5392569 100644
--- a/system/vl.c
+++ b/system/vl.c
@@ -3239,8 +3239,11 @@ void qemu_init(int argc, char **argv)
                  default_monitor = 0;
                  break;
              case QEMU_OPTION_mon:
-                warn_report_once("'-mon' is deprecated, use '-object' with "
-                                 "'monitor-hmp' or 'monitor-qmp' types 
instead");
+                warn_report_once("'-mon' is deprecated. Switch to either "
+                                 "'-object monitor-hmp,id=ID,chardev=CHR-ID' "
+                                 "or '-object monitor-qmp,id=qmpNN,chardev=CHR-ID' 
"
+                                 "instead. See '-object' docs in 'qemu(1)' for 
further "
+                                 "configuration guidance.");

Looking at commit 58b70f21ba6 ("docs: mark '-mon' as deprecated in
favour of -object") I'm not sure this is a good idea to document
'-object monitor-qmp' at all on CLI help. CLI users looking at
help output are likely users of '-mon' for HMP. My 2 cents.
